The Complete Overview of Deck Installation Costs

The average homeowner spends between **$15,000 and $40,000** on a deck, but that range is deceptive. A 12’x16’ pressure-treated wood deck in a low-cost region might land at the lower end, while a 20’x30’ composite deck with a pergola, outdoor kitchen, and custom lighting could exceed $60,000. The discrepancy stems from three core variables: **material selection, labor rates, and project complexity**. Materials alone account for 30–50% of the total cost, with composite decking (like Trex or TimberTech) running **$15–$30 per square foot** compared to $8–$15 for pressure-treated wood. Labor, meanwhile, varies by region—$40–$80 per hour in the Midwest versus $70–$120 in coastal cities—while complexity (stairs, railings, built-ins) can add **$10,000+** to the tab. What’s often overlooked is the **indirect cost** of installing a deck. Permits, site prep (grading, drainage), and unexpected soil conditions (like expansive clay or poor drainage) can inflate budgets by 20–30%. For example, a deck built on a sloped yard might require **retaining walls or additional footings**, adding $5,000–$15,000. Similarly, if your local building code mandates a **42-inch minimum railing height** (common in California), the standard 36-inch railing upgrade could cost an extra $1,500–$3,000 for materials and labor. These are the silent budget killers that turn a "simple" deck project into a financial minefield.

Core Mechanisms: How It Works

A deck’s cost structure follows a **three-tiered model**: foundation, framing, and finish. The foundation—**footings, beams, and joists**—is the most critical (and often most expensive) part. Concrete footings (typically 12"x12"x24") cost **$500–$1,500 each**, depending on depth and soil type. In areas with **expansive clay**, footings may need to extend **4–6 feet deep**, adding $2,000–$5,000 to the project. Framing, usually **pressure-treated lumber or galvanized steel**, runs **$3–$10 per linear foot**, while the finish (decking boards, railings, stairs) accounts for **40–60% of material costs**. Labor costs are tied to **time and skill level**. A basic 10’x12’ deck might take **3–5 days** for a crew of three, while a **multi-level deck with built-ins** could take **2–3 weeks**. Contractors typically charge **$15–$30 per square foot** for labor, but this drops to **$10–$20** if you opt for **DIY framing** (though most homeowners hire pros for structural work). The hidden variable? **Waste**. Decking boards often crack or warp during installation, adding **10–20% to material costs**. Pro tip: Buy **10–15% extra** to account for this.

Comparative Analysis

Factor Pressure-Treated Wood Composite Decking PVC Decking
Cost per Sq. Ft. $8–$15 $15–$30 $20–$40
Lifespan 10–15 years (with treatment) 25–30 years 20–25 years
Maintenance High (sealing, staining, rot repair) Low (annual cleaning) Very Low (resistant to mold/mildew)
ROI at Resale 50–70% recouped 80–90% recouped 75–85% recouped

Comprehensive FAQs

Q: Can I build a deck myself to save money?

A: **Yes, but only for simple, ground-level decks.** DIY framing (footings, beams) is risky without structural expertise, while railings and stairs require **local building code compliance**. Labor costs account for **40–60% of the total**, so DIY can save **$5,000–$15,000** on a $20,000 project—but mistakes (like improper spacing or rot-prone wood) can **double repair costs**. For multi-level or complex decks, **hire a licensed contractor** to avoid voiding homeowner’s insurance.

Q: How long does a deck installation typically take?

A: **Basic decks (10’x12’)**: **3–7 days** (including permits and inspections). **Mid-range decks (16’x20’)**: **1–2 weeks**. **Complex decks (multi-level, built-ins, pergolas)**: **3–6 weeks**. Delays often come from: - **Permit processing** (2–4 weeks in some cities). - **Material lead times** (composite decking can take **6–8 weeks** to ship). - **Weather** (rain or extreme heat halts framing). **Pro tip:** Schedule installations in **spring or early fall** to avoid peak contractor demand.

Q: What’s the biggest mistake homeowners make when budgeting for a deck?

A: **Underestimating site prep costs.** Many assume the quoted price covers "just the deck," but **excavation, grading, and drainage** can add **$3,000–$10,000**. Other pitfalls: - **Skipping a soil test** ($300–$800) to avoid **$5,000+ in footing repairs**. - **Choosing cheap railings** that don’t meet **local wind/ice load codes**, risking **$2,000+ in fines or replacements**. - **Ignoring slope adjustments**—a deck on a 10% grade may need **retaining walls** ($15–$30 per linear foot). **Rule of thumb:** Add **15–20% to your budget** for contingencies.
